Effects of probiotic D2/CSL (CECT 4529) on the nutritional and health status of boxer dogs.

Abstract

BACKGROUND

The aim of the present study was to investigate the effects of D2/CSL (CECT 4529) probiotic strain on nutritional status and faecal and microbiological parameters in a group of purebred boxers.

METHODS

Forty healthy adult boxer dogs were randomly assigned to a treated (LACTO) group receiving a commercial diet supplemented with D2/CSL (CECT 4529) to a final concentration of 5.0 x 10 colony-forming unit/kg of food, and a control (CTR) group receiving the same diet but without the probiotic (placebo). Nutritional status (body weight, skinfold thickness, body condition score) and faecal quality parameters were analysed.

RESULTS

No differences in body weight and skin thickness were found during the whole experimental period. Dogs in the LACTO group showed a significantly higher body condition score than those in the CTR group (4.86±0.55 v 4.65±0.65), and no significant differences were recorded in body weight and skinfold thickness. The LACTO group showed a significantly lower faecal moisture (in per cent) compared with the CTR group (0.67±0.007 v 0.69±0.007). Faecal hardness (in kg) was higher in the LACTO group than in the CTR group (0.86±0.047 v 0.70±0.051), and faecal score also improved in the LACTO group (3.78±0.95 v 4.25±0.91). A significant difference in total counts as well as in lactobacilli counts between the CTR and LACTO groups was only detected at 28 days.

CONCLUSION

Supplementation of D2/CSL (CECT 4529) significantly improved the nutritional status and faecal parameters of dogs.

摘要

背景

本研究旨在研究 D2/CSL(CECT 4529)益生菌菌株对一组纯种拳师犬营养状况以及粪便和微生物参数的影响。

方法

40 只健康成年拳师犬被随机分为治疗组(LACTO)和对照组(CTR)。治疗组接受添加了 D2/CSL(CECT 4529)的商业饮食,最终浓度为 5.0×10 菌落形成单位/公斤食物,对照组接受相同的饮食,但不含益生菌(安慰剂)。分析营养状况(体重、皮褶厚度、身体状况评分)和粪便质量参数。

结果

在整个实验期间,体重和皮肤厚度均无差异。LACTO 组的犬体况评分明显高于 CTR 组(4.86±0.55 比 4.65±0.65),而体重和皮褶厚度无明显差异。LACTO 组的粪便水分(以百分比表示)明显低于 CTR 组(0.67±0.007 比 0.69±0.007)。LACTO 组的粪便硬度(以千克表示)高于 CTR 组(0.86±0.047 比 0.70±0.051),粪便评分也有所改善(3.78±0.95 比 4.25±0.91)。仅在 28 天时,CTR 和 LACTO 组之间的总计数以及乳杆菌计数存在显著差异。

结论

补充 D2/CSL(CECT 4529)可显著改善犬的营养状况和粪便参数。
